About The role

We’re looking for a warm, energetic and highly organised Guest Experience & Culture Champion to help make our Sydney office feel welcoming, vibrant and brilliantly run.

You’ll be the friendly face of the office — greeting guests, supporting visitors, keeping our front-of-house space humming, setting up meeting rooms, coordinating supplies, managing mail and deliveries, and making sure the little details are taken care of.

More than keeping things running smoothly, you’ll help bring the office to life. Think great first impressions, a well-stocked kitchen, a beautifully presented workspace, and those small “surprise and delight” moments that make people feel genuinely welcome.

  • Own the front-of-house experience: Manage the daily flow of the front desk, visitor access, meeting room readiness, mail, deliveries, and office presentation.
  • Keep the office running smoothly: Stay across kitchen and beverage stock, office supplies, shared spaces, meeting rooms, and general workplace presentation.
  • Bring the workplace vibe to life: Help create a warm, social and high-care office environment through thoughtful touches, small “surprise and delight” moments, and an eye for what will make the day feel easier or better for the team.
  • Support our people behind the scenes: Coordinate workplace logistics for new starters, movers and leavers, including access cards, security passes, parking, desk setup, and other office needs.
  • Stay on top of maintenance and facilities requests: Log, track and follow up on office issues, repairs and scheduled services, working with building management, landlords and suppliers to get things resolved quickly.
  • Work with our office partners: Coordinate with cleaners, security, maintenance providers and other suppliers to ensure our spaces stay safe, clean, stocked, and well presented.
  • Keep things organised and visible: Maintain simple trackers, reports and documentation for office requests, supplies, maintenance activity, access, suppliers, and key facilities processes.
  • Jump in where needed: Support ad hoc such as urgent repairs, office events, VIP visits, team activations, and other requests.

Qualifications

  • Experience in hospitality, events, customer experience, premium front-of-house, workplace experience, facilities, office coordination, or a similar service-led role.
  • A naturally warm, energetic and welcoming style, with the confidence to engage with employees, guests and senior stakeholders.
  • A strong service mindset and the ability to create a positive, high-care experience for everyone who enters the office.
  • Excellent organisation skills, attention to detail and the ability to stay calm while juggling multiple priorities.
  • A proactive approach — you notice what needs doing and take ownership without waiting to be asked.
  • Strong communication skills, with the ability to provide clear updates and build trusted relationships across teams.
  • Confidence coordinating suppliers, building management, maintenance providers, cleaners, security teams or other external partners.
  • Comfort using Microsoft Office Suite and workplace systems to manage requests, trackers, documentation and reporting.
  • Flexibility to respond to unplanned issues, office needs, events and day-to-day operational requests.
